π§ Ingredients
- π 3 ripe bananas, mashed
- π₯ 2 eggs
- π§ Β½ cup melted butter or oil
- π¬ ΒΎ cup sugar (adjust to taste)
- πΌ 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- πΎ 1Β½ cups all-purpose flour
- π§ 1 teaspoon baking soda
- π§ Β½ teaspoon salt
- π° Optional: Β½ cup chopped walnuts or chocolate chips
π©βπ³ Instructions
- π₯ Preheat oven to 175Β°C (350Β°F). Grease a loaf pan.
- π₯£ In a bowl, mix mashed bananas, eggs, butter, sugar, and vanilla.
- πΎ In another bowl, whisk flour, baking soda, and salt.
- π₯ Combine wet and dry ingredients. Fold in nuts or chocolate if using.
- π Pour batter into pan and smooth the top.
- π₯ Bake for 50β60 minutes until golden and a toothpick comes out clean.
- βοΈ Cool before slicing. Serve plain or with butter or jam π―.
π Methods
- Use brown sugar or honey for deeper flavor π―.
- Add cinnamon or nutmeg for warmth π°.
- Make muffins instead of a loaf π§.
- Top with sliced bananas or oats before baking ππΎ.
π History
Banana bread became popular in the 1930s in America πΊπΈ and spread worldwide π. Moroccan bakers π²π¦ love its simplicity and use it to avoid wasting ripe bananas.
